Message ID | 20210916095304.3058210-1-qi.z.zhang@intel.com (mailing list archive) |
---|---|
Headers |
Return-Path: <dev-bounces@dpdk.org> X-Original-To: patchwork@inbox.dpdk.org Delivered-To: patchwork@inbox.dpdk.org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id BB0EFA0C41; Thu, 16 Sep 2021 11:50:02 +0200 (CEST) Received: from [217.70.189.124] (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id 3FC2040151; Thu, 16 Sep 2021 11:50:02 +0200 (CEST) Received: from mga14.intel.com (mga14.intel.com [192.55.52.115]) by mails.dpdk.org (Postfix) with ESMTP id 0D9214003F for <dev@dpdk.org>; Thu, 16 Sep 2021 11:50:00 +0200 (CEST) X-IronPort-AV: E=McAfee;i="6200,9189,10108"; a="222185839" X-IronPort-AV: E=Sophos;i="5.85,298,1624345200"; d="scan'208";a="222185839" Received: from fmsmga008.fm.intel.com ([10.253.24.58]) by fmsmga103.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 16 Sep 2021 02:49:59 -0700 X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="5.85,298,1624345200"; d="scan'208";a="509246830" Received: from dpdk51.sh.intel.com ([10.67.111.142]) by fmsmga008.fm.intel.com with ESMTP; 16 Sep 2021 02:49:58 -0700 From: Qi Zhang <qi.z.zhang@intel.com> To: qiming.yang@intel.com Cc: junfeng.guo@intel.com, dev@dpdk.org, Qi Zhang <qi.z.zhang@intel.com> Date: Thu, 16 Sep 2021 17:52:52 +0800 Message-Id: <20210916095304.3058210-1-qi.z.zhang@intel.com> X-Mailer: git-send-email 2.26.2 MIME-Version: 1.0 Content-Transfer-Encoding: 8bit Subject: [dpdk-dev] [PATCH 00/12] ice base code batch 2 for DPDK 21.11 X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ions <dev.dpdk.org> List-Unsubscribe: <https://mails.dpdk.org/options/dev>, <mailto:dev-request@dpdk.org?subject=unsubscribe> List-Archive: <http://mails.dpdk.org/archives/dev/> List-Post: <mailto:dev@dpdk.org> List-Help: <mailto:dev-request@dpdk.org?subject=help> List-Subscribe: <https://mails.dpdk.org/listinfo/dev>, <mailto:dev-request@dpdk.org?subject=subscribe> Errors-To: dev-bounces@dpdk.org Sender: "dev" <dev-bounces@dpdk.org> |
Series |
ice base code batch 2 for DPDK 21.11
|
|
Message
Qi Zhang
Sept. 16, 2021, 9:52 a.m. UTC
Qi Zhang (12): net/ice/base: calculate logical PF ID net/ice/base: include more E810T adapters net/ice/base: use macro instead of open-coded division net/ice/base: allow to enable LAN and loopback in switch net/ice/base: change addr param to u16 net/ice/base: allow tool access to MNG register net/ice/base: add package segment ID net/ice/base: add a helper to check for 100M speed support net/ice/base: add GCO defines and new GCO flex descriptor net/ice/base: add get/set functions for shared parameters net/ice/base: implement support for SMA controller net/ice/base: update auto generated hardware register drivers/net/ice/base/ice_adminq_cmd.h | 10 + drivers/net/ice/base/ice_common.c | 134 ++++++++++++- drivers/net/ice/base/ice_common.h | 7 + drivers/net/ice/base/ice_devids.h | 1 + drivers/net/ice/base/ice_flex_pipe.c | 11 +- drivers/net/ice/base/ice_flex_type.h | 2 +- drivers/net/ice/base/ice_hw_autogen.h | 148 +++++++------- drivers/net/ice/base/ice_lan_tx_rx.h | 49 ++++- drivers/net/ice/base/ice_nvm.c | 7 +- drivers/net/ice/base/ice_nvm.h | 13 -- drivers/net/ice/base/ice_ptp_hw.c | 270 +++++++++++++++++++++++--- drivers/net/ice/base/ice_ptp_hw.h | 11 ++ drivers/net/ice/base/ice_switch.c | 7 +- drivers/net/ice/base/ice_switch.h | 11 ++ drivers/net/ice/base/ice_type.h | 3 + 15 files changed, 569 insertions(+), 115 deletions(-)
Comments
> -----Original Message----- > From: Zhang, Qi Z <qi.z.zhang@intel.com> > Sent: Thursday, September 16, 2021 17:53 > To: Yang, Qiming <qiming.yang@intel.com> > Cc: Guo, Junfeng <junfeng.guo@intel.com>; dev@dpdk.org; Zhang, Qi Z > <qi.z.zhang@intel.com> > Subject: [PATCH 00/12] ice base code batch 2 for DPDK 21.11 > > Qi Zhang (12): > net/ice/base: calculate logical PF ID > net/ice/base: include more E810T adapters > net/ice/base: use macro instead of open-coded division > net/ice/base: allow to enable LAN and loopback in switch > net/ice/base: change addr param to u16 > net/ice/base: allow tool access to MNG register > net/ice/base: add package segment ID > net/ice/base: add a helper to check for 100M speed support > net/ice/base: add GCO defines and new GCO flex descriptor > net/ice/base: add get/set functions for shared parameters > net/ice/base: implement support for SMA controller > net/ice/base: update auto generated hardware register > > drivers/net/ice/base/ice_adminq_cmd.h | 10 + > drivers/net/ice/base/ice_common.c | 134 ++++++++++++- > drivers/net/ice/base/ice_common.h | 7 + > drivers/net/ice/base/ice_devids.h | 1 + > drivers/net/ice/base/ice_flex_pipe.c | 11 +- > drivers/net/ice/base/ice_flex_type.h | 2 +- > drivers/net/ice/base/ice_hw_autogen.h | 148 +++++++------- > drivers/net/ice/base/ice_lan_tx_rx.h | 49 ++++- > drivers/net/ice/base/ice_nvm.c | 7 +- > drivers/net/ice/base/ice_nvm.h | 13 -- > drivers/net/ice/base/ice_ptp_hw.c | 270 +++++++++++++++++++++++-- > - > drivers/net/ice/base/ice_ptp_hw.h | 11 ++ > drivers/net/ice/base/ice_switch.c | 7 +- > drivers/net/ice/base/ice_switch.h | 11 ++ > drivers/net/ice/base/ice_type.h | 3 + > 15 files changed, 569 insertions(+), 115 deletions(-) > > -- > 2.26.2 Acked-by: Junfeng Guo <junfeng.guo@intel.com> Regards, Junfeng Guo
> -----Original Message----- > From: Guo, Junfeng <junfeng.guo@intel.com> > Sent: Friday, September 17, 2021 10:14 AM > To: Zhang, Qi Z <qi.z.zhang@intel.com>; Yang, Qiming > <qiming.yang@intel.com> > Cc: dev@dpdk.org > Subject: RE: [PATCH 00/12] ice base code batch 2 for DPDK 21.11 > > > > > -----Original Message----- > > From: Zhang, Qi Z <qi.z.zhang@intel.com> > > Sent: Thursday, September 16, 2021 17:53 > > To: Yang, Qiming <qiming.yang@intel.com> > > Cc: Guo, Junfeng <junfeng.guo@intel.com>; dev@dpdk.org; Zhang, Qi Z > > <qi.z.zhang@intel.com> > > Subject: [PATCH 00/12] ice base code batch 2 for DPDK 21.11 > > > > Qi Zhang (12): > > net/ice/base: calculate logical PF ID > > net/ice/base: include more E810T adapters > > net/ice/base: use macro instead of open-coded division > > net/ice/base: allow to enable LAN and loopback in switch > > net/ice/base: change addr param to u16 > > net/ice/base: allow tool access to MNG register > > net/ice/base: add package segment ID > > net/ice/base: add a helper to check for 100M speed support > > net/ice/base: add GCO defines and new GCO flex descriptor > > net/ice/base: add get/set functions for shared parameters > > net/ice/base: implement support for SMA controller > > net/ice/base: update auto generated hardware register > > > > drivers/net/ice/base/ice_adminq_cmd.h | 10 + > > drivers/net/ice/base/ice_common.c | 134 ++++++++++++- > > drivers/net/ice/base/ice_common.h | 7 + > > drivers/net/ice/base/ice_devids.h | 1 + > > drivers/net/ice/base/ice_flex_pipe.c | 11 +- > > drivers/net/ice/base/ice_flex_type.h | 2 +- > > drivers/net/ice/base/ice_hw_autogen.h | 148 +++++++------- > > drivers/net/ice/base/ice_lan_tx_rx.h | 49 ++++- > > drivers/net/ice/base/ice_nvm.c | 7 +- > > drivers/net/ice/base/ice_nvm.h | 13 -- > > drivers/net/ice/base/ice_ptp_hw.c | 270 +++++++++++++++++++++++-- > > - > > drivers/net/ice/base/ice_ptp_hw.h | 11 ++ > > drivers/net/ice/base/ice_switch.c | 7 +- > > drivers/net/ice/base/ice_switch.h | 11 ++ > > drivers/net/ice/base/ice_type.h | 3 + > > 15 files changed, 569 insertions(+), 115 deletions(-) > > > > -- > > 2.26.2 > > Acked-by: Junfeng Guo <junfeng.guo@intel.com> Applied to dpdk-next-net-intel. Thanks Qi > > Regards, > Junfeng Guo >
On 9/17/2021 9:48 AM, Zhang, Qi Z wrote: > > >> -----Original Message----- >> From: Guo, Junfeng <junfeng.guo@intel.com> >> Sent: Friday, September 17, 2021 10:14 AM >> To: Zhang, Qi Z <qi.z.zhang@intel.com>; Yang, Qiming >> <qiming.yang@intel.com> >> Cc: dev@dpdk.org >> Subject: RE: [PATCH 00/12] ice base code batch 2 for DPDK 21.11 >> >> >> >>> -----Original Message----- >>> From: Zhang, Qi Z <qi.z.zhang@intel.com> >>> Sent: Thursday, September 16, 2021 17:53 >>> To: Yang, Qiming <qiming.yang@intel.com> >>> Cc: Guo, Junfeng <junfeng.guo@intel.com>; dev@dpdk.org; Zhang, Qi Z >>> <qi.z.zhang@intel.com> >>> Subject: [PATCH 00/12] ice base code batch 2 for DPDK 21.11 >>> >>> Qi Zhang (12): >>> net/ice/base: calculate logical PF ID >>> net/ice/base: include more E810T adapters >>> net/ice/base: use macro instead of open-coded division >>> net/ice/base: allow to enable LAN and loopback in switch >>> net/ice/base: change addr param to u16 >>> net/ice/base: allow tool access to MNG register >>> net/ice/base: add package segment ID >>> net/ice/base: add a helper to check for 100M speed support >>> net/ice/base: add GCO defines and new GCO flex descriptor >>> net/ice/base: add get/set functions for shared parameters >>> net/ice/base: implement support for SMA controller >>> net/ice/base: update auto generated hardware register >>> >>> drivers/net/ice/base/ice_adminq_cmd.h | 10 + >>> drivers/net/ice/base/ice_common.c | 134 ++++++++++++- >>> drivers/net/ice/base/ice_common.h | 7 + >>> drivers/net/ice/base/ice_devids.h | 1 + >>> drivers/net/ice/base/ice_flex_pipe.c | 11 +- >>> drivers/net/ice/base/ice_flex_type.h | 2 +- >>> drivers/net/ice/base/ice_hw_autogen.h | 148 +++++++------- >>> drivers/net/ice/base/ice_lan_tx_rx.h | 49 ++++- >>> drivers/net/ice/base/ice_nvm.c | 7 +- >>> drivers/net/ice/base/ice_nvm.h | 13 -- >>> drivers/net/ice/base/ice_ptp_hw.c | 270 +++++++++++++++++++++++-- >>> - >>> drivers/net/ice/base/ice_ptp_hw.h | 11 ++ >>> drivers/net/ice/base/ice_switch.c | 7 +- >>> drivers/net/ice/base/ice_switch.h | 11 ++ >>> drivers/net/ice/base/ice_type.h | 3 + >>> 15 files changed, 569 insertions(+), 115 deletions(-) >>> >>> -- >>> 2.26.2 >> >> Acked-by: Junfeng Guo <junfeng.guo@intel.com> > > Applied to dpdk-next-net-intel. > Hi Qi, Junfeng, Qiming, Won't the version information in the 'drivers/net/ice/base/README' updated with these changes? Thanks, ferruh
> -----Original Message----- > From: Yigit, Ferruh <ferruh.yigit@intel.com> > Sent: Wednesday, September 22, 2021 8:45 PM > To: Zhang, Qi Z <qi.z.zhang@intel.com>; Guo, Junfeng > <junfeng.guo@intel.com>; Yang, Qiming <qiming.yang@intel.com> > Cc: dev@dpdk.org > Subject: Re: [dpdk-dev] [PATCH 00/12] ice base code batch 2 for DPDK 21.11 > > On 9/17/2021 9:48 AM, Zhang, Qi Z wrote: > > > > > >> -----Original Message----- > >> From: Guo, Junfeng <junfeng.guo@intel.com> > >> Sent: Friday, September 17, 2021 10:14 AM > >> To: Zhang, Qi Z <qi.z.zhang@intel.com>; Yang, Qiming > >> <qiming.yang@intel.com> > >> Cc: dev@dpdk.org > >> Subject: RE: [PATCH 00/12] ice base code batch 2 for DPDK 21.11 > >> > >> > >> > >>> -----Original Message----- > >>> From: Zhang, Qi Z <qi.z.zhang@intel.com> > >>> Sent: Thursday, September 16, 2021 17:53 > >>> To: Yang, Qiming <qiming.yang@intel.com> > >>> Cc: Guo, Junfeng <junfeng.guo@intel.com>; dev@dpdk.org; Zhang, Qi Z > >>> <qi.z.zhang@intel.com> > >>> Subject: [PATCH 00/12] ice base code batch 2 for DPDK 21.11 > >>> > >>> Qi Zhang (12): > >>> net/ice/base: calculate logical PF ID > >>> net/ice/base: include more E810T adapters > >>> net/ice/base: use macro instead of open-coded division > >>> net/ice/base: allow to enable LAN and loopback in switch > >>> net/ice/base: change addr param to u16 > >>> net/ice/base: allow tool access to MNG register > >>> net/ice/base: add package segment ID > >>> net/ice/base: add a helper to check for 100M speed support > >>> net/ice/base: add GCO defines and new GCO flex descriptor > >>> net/ice/base: add get/set functions for shared parameters > >>> net/ice/base: implement support for SMA controller > >>> net/ice/base: update auto generated hardware register > >>> > >>> drivers/net/ice/base/ice_adminq_cmd.h | 10 + > >>> drivers/net/ice/base/ice_common.c | 134 ++++++++++++- > >>> drivers/net/ice/base/ice_common.h | 7 + > >>> drivers/net/ice/base/ice_devids.h | 1 + > >>> drivers/net/ice/base/ice_flex_pipe.c | 11 +- > >>> drivers/net/ice/base/ice_flex_type.h | 2 +- > >>> drivers/net/ice/base/ice_hw_autogen.h | 148 +++++++------- > >>> drivers/net/ice/base/ice_lan_tx_rx.h | 49 ++++- > >>> drivers/net/ice/base/ice_nvm.c | 7 +- > >>> drivers/net/ice/base/ice_nvm.h | 13 -- > >>> drivers/net/ice/base/ice_ptp_hw.c | 270 > +++++++++++++++++++++++-- > >>> - > >>> drivers/net/ice/base/ice_ptp_hw.h | 11 ++ > >>> drivers/net/ice/base/ice_switch.c | 7 +- > >>> drivers/net/ice/base/ice_switch.h | 11 ++ > >>> drivers/net/ice/base/ice_type.h | 3 + > >>> 15 files changed, 569 insertions(+), 115 deletions(-) > >>> > >>> -- > >>> 2.26.2 > >> > >> Acked-by: Junfeng Guo <junfeng.guo@intel.com> > > > > Applied to dpdk-next-net-intel. > > > > Hi Qi, Junfeng, Qiming, > > Won't the version information in the 'drivers/net/ice/base/README' updated > with these changes? There will be more base code update for DPDK 21.11, we will update it in following patches. Thanks Qi > > Thanks, > ferruh